T835-600B is a high-performance triac used in applications that require high power handling and precise current control. The T835-600B-TR version enables easier automated component assembly in mass production processes, especially in SMT (Surface Mount Technology) systems.

T835-600B (Triac)

  • It (Average on-state current): 8A – This means the triac can handle up to 8 amperes of continuous current during operation.
  • Vdrm (Maximum repetitive off-state voltage): 600V – The triac is designed to operate with voltages up to 600 volts in the off state, making it suitable for various high-current applications.
  • Igt (Gate trigger current): 8mA – This is the minimum current required to trigger the triac. A lower gate trigger current allows for easier control, which is beneficial in low-voltage control circuits.

Features:

  • Wide application in automation systems – Especially useful in applications where current control is needed in AC (alternating current) circuits.
  • Excellent stability – The design offers high resistance to voltage and current stress, ensuring reliable performance in demanding conditions.

Applications:

  • Electric motor control.
  • Power regulation in heating devices.
  • Lighting systems and dimmer control.
  • AC circuit applications where precise switching on and off is required.
